Top 10 Noise Cancelling Earbuds for Crystal-Clear Audio in 2025

Check out our curated list of the best noise-canceling earbuds of 2025, rated on the parameters of active noise cancellation, sound quality, and comfort. Each excels at crushing ambient noise with unique additional features.

  • Bose QuietComfort Ultra Earbuds ($299): Industry-leading ANC, immersive spatial audio, 6-hour battery life, IPX4 rating. Perfect for travel. Pros: Unmatched noise reduction (34-39dB). Cons: Shorter battery life.
  • Sony WF-1000XM5 ($299): Rich sound, LDAC codec for hi-res audio, 8-hour battery, IPX4. Ideal for audiophiles. Pros: Detailed audio. Cons: Pricey.
  • Apple AirPods Pro 2 ($249): Adaptive audio, seamless Apple integration, 6-hour battery, IP54. Great for iPhone users. Pros: Intuitive controls. Cons: iOS-focused.
  • Jabra Elite 8 Active Gen 2 ($229): Durable build, strong ANC, 8-hour battery, IP68. Best for workouts. Pros: Rugged design. Cons: Call quality lags.
  • Samsung Galaxy Buds3 Pro ($249): Solid ANC, vibrant sound, 7-hour battery, IPX7. Android-friendly. Pros: Waterproof. Cons: App is Android-only.
  • Technics EAH-AZ100 ($349): Premium sound, triple-device connectivity, 7-hour battery, IPX4. Pros: Clear calls. Cons: Expensive.
  • Anker Soundcore Liberty 4 Pro ($129): Budget-friendly, strong ANC, 8-hour battery, IPX4. Pros: Affordable. Cons: Less premium feel.
  • Sennheiser Momentum True Wireless 4 ($299): Rich audio, very good ANC, 7-hour battery, IPX4. Pros: Stylish. Cons: Fit varies.
  • Bowers & Wilkins Pi8 ($399): Luxe sound, good ANC, 6.5-hour battery, IPX4. Pros: Elegant design. Cons: High price.
  • Bang & Olufsen Beoplay EX ($399): Balanced audio, premium build, 6-hour battery, IP57. Pros: Comfortable. Cons: ANC not top-tier.

What makes best noise cancelling earbuds immersive? Active noise cancelation helps to make noise-canceling earbuds immersive by using tiny microphones to listen to nearby noise and cancel it out with inverse sound waves. This process combined with the sophisticated design creates a bubble of silence. By the year 2025, spatial audio will further enhance the experience and let you customize your EQ settings.

How ANC Works:

  1. Microphones: Capture external sounds like engine rumbles or chatter.
  2. Processors: Generate opposing sound waves to cancel noise.
  3. Seals: Ear tips block passive noise, enhancing ANC.

Muffling ambient noise is the hallmark of best noise cancelling earbuds. In 2025, ANC performance varies by frequency low (engines), mid (voices), and high (whines). Bose excels at low frequencies, reducing 34-39dB, while Sony handles high frequencies better (39dB >1kHz).

Transparency Modes:Commonly, all of these wireless earphones come with hear-in modes for awareness. Adaptive Audio from Apple learns and changes according to the situational circumstances to include announcements of the train such that it can be heard while not removing the earbud. Jabra’s HearThrough feature does that, but it is not too versatile since it works great for those one-time short conversations.

Fit Matters: A tight seal boosts ANC. Try different ear tip sizes—Sony includes four, Jabra adds concha fins. For workouts, Jabra’s IP68 rating ensures sweat resistance.
